Dear Parents and Guardians,

A new state law, Senate Bill 12, requires school districts to notify families about the health services we provide and to collect your permission before your child can receive these services at school.

Here’s what you need to know:

  • Starting September 1, 2025, we must have your opt-in consent on file before school staff, including nurses, teachers, counselors, social workers, and in some cases, coaches, can provide health-related services for your child.

Without consent, staff will not be able to perform even basic care, such as taking a temperature for a sick child or cleaning a scraped knee.

  • In an emergency, staff will always provide care, even without consent.

You have received an email from PowerSchool with instructions to update your child’s registration forms. If you have not received an email from PowerSchool, please check your spam or junk folders or contact your school's office. 

  • The form includes two separate questions: one for health services and one for mental health services. You may choose to opt in for either, both, or neither, depending on your preferences.

Please take a few minutes to complete the form once you receive the notification. This ensures your child can continue receiving the health services you approve during the school day.

Pie grant

Mrs.Connair is blessed to be the recipient of a Partners in Education (PIE) Grant! This project will integrate KUBO Coding Math Kits into K-5 classrooms and small group sessions, with a strong focus on K-2, to enhance math instruction through hands-on, play-based learning. KUBO's screen-free robots use tangible coding tiles that align with foundational math concepts and TEKS such as sequencing, number recognition, patterns, spatial awareness, and problem-solving. Early learners often struggle to engage with abstract math ideas; this project addresses that need by making learning interactive, visual, and developmentally appropriate. By combining math and coding, the project fosters critical thinking, collaboration, and perseverance while reinforcing key math standards.
